20404627
0xf99a667ff13c41eb711981d0763ddc9772fe1414191459706718c246d284ae52
Transactions23
Height20404627
Confirmations1568370
Timestamp244 days 15 hours ago
Size (bytes)3127
Version
Merkle Root
Nonce0xb4eaeb9ab22b64bc
Bits
Difficulty0x82fb8b54702be

Transactions